MySQL,作为一款开源的关系型数据库管理系统,凭借其高性能、可靠性和易用性,在Web应用、数据分析、企业信息化等多个领域得到了广泛应用
然而,对于运维人员或开发人员而言,如何高效、安全地远程访问和管理MySQL数据库,成为了提升工作效率与保障数据安全的关键
本文将详细介绍如何通过Xshell这一功能强大的终端模拟软件,实现远程连接MySQL数据库,旨在为读者提供一套实用的操作指南与最佳实践
一、Xshell简介与优势 Xshell是一款专为Windows平台设计的免费SSH客户端软件,它提供了包括SSH、SFTP、TELNET等多种协议的支持,使得用户能够安全、便捷地远程访问和管理服务器
相较于其他同类工具,Xshell以其简洁的界面设计、强大的功能集、以及对多种编码格式的良好支持,赢得了广大用户的青睐
特别是其内置的终端模拟器,为用户提供了一个稳定、高效的命令行操作环境,这对于执行复杂的数据库管理任务尤为重要
二、准备工作 在正式通过Xshell远程连接MySQL之前,需要做好以下几项准备工作: 1.安装Xshell:首先,从官方网站下载并安装最新版本的Xshell
安装过程简单明了,按照提示完成即可
2.MySQL服务器配置:确保MySQL服务器已启动,并且配置了允许远程连接
这通常涉及修改MySQL的配置文件(如`my.cnf`或`my.ini`),找到`bind-address`参数,将其设置为服务器的IP地址或`0.0.0.0`以接受所有IP的连接请求
同时,确保MySQL用户具有从远程主机访问的权限
3.防火墙设置:检查服务器和客户端的防火墙设置,确保MySQL默认端口(3306)未被阻塞
4.获取服务器信息:记录下需要连接的MySQL服务器的IP地址、用户名、密码以及可能的端口号(默认3306)
三、通过Xsh
黑QNAP Hyper-V安全隐忧解析
Xshell远程操控:轻松连接MySQL数据库
Linux技巧:高效抓取整站内容
Linux命令ls:解锁文件目录管理的强大工具
Linux:ARP与ifconfig网络配置详解
Linux系统高效释放资源请求技巧
Linux选择:Y或N,你的决策时刻!
Xshell断开后,如何高效应对与解决
Xshell属性配置全攻略:如何精准设置以提升远程连接效率
Xshell中MySQL启动失败解决方案
免费Xshell助力:轻松连接SSH终端,高效远程操作指南
Xshell 5.0.1333注册教程详解
Xshell版本过期,如何解决更新问题?
Xshell 6新增用户操作指南
Xshell教程:轻松实现文件上传到虚拟机的方法
Xshell连接AWS搭建翻墙教程指南
Xshell连接本地主机(localhost)教程
Linux远程执行Shell命令技巧揭秘
Xshell5安装教程:轻松上手步骤